Design Of Campus Constant Pressure Water Supply Systems Based On PLC

With the continuous expansion of the city scale,the scale of vocational schools in expanding is expanding day by day.The campus water supply capacity is increasingly affecting the life of teachers and students,and the requirements for the safety and reliability of water supply are also increasing.It also has the same problem of water supply for teachers and students in Zhejiang Information Engineering School.Based on this demand,an electrical control system is designed and produced integrating manual control,semi-automatic control and automatic constant pressure water supply.The system has the functions of on-line remote monitoring and online configuration parameter setting,effectively solved the water problem of teachers and students in the school.Mainly complete the following work as below:By observing and investigating the situation of water consumption in Zhejiang Information Engineering School,and the change of water supply pressure,it can get the reasonable pressure data of the campus water supply,which lays a foundation for the design of campus water supply system.According to the survey data and the actual demand of the campus water supply system,a set of campus constant pressure water supply system with automatic,semi-active and manual functions is designed.In order to prolong the service life of water supply system,redundant design schemes of main control system and standby control system are adopted.For record the running data of the system in real time,the upper computer configuration based on force control configuration software is designed to realize human-computer interaction and system monitoring function.Otherwise,for the sake of facilitate the water supply management personnel to understand the operation of the system online,it through the GSM communication technology,the operator can input the operating parameters of the mobile phone short message into the reporting system,also it can switch the system operation mode based on the mobile phone short message instruction to realize the remote control functions.Besides,a variety of system operation protection modes are designed to ensure the stable operation of the system.3.According to the system design function,the hardware and software implementation scheme of constant pressure water supply system is designed.The hardware system of Siemens S7-200 PLC and Siemens MM430 inverter are used as the core module.The PID control algorithm is designed based on PLC.As well as get the built-in data recording and human-computer interaction system which based on the force control software.Through a period of input and operation practice,it is proved that the water supply facility can satisfy the water resources of nearly 5,000 teachers and students who in Zhejiang Information Engineering School,thereby ensuring their study and life in school.So it can verifying the reliability of the system.
